I'm afraid there will never be a newer version. ioplong was close to a bug fixed version but he lost the code. (burglary :cry: ). There is a beta (works not in all hosts) version of this version, but its only for donators. Details in the audiomulch mailing list. (search for ioplongs posts there reagarding slifty)

Hiya,
Its not quite as bad as Al Magnifico said. I've *not* lost all the code, only what i was working on the 2 or so weeks before the burglary.. so there is hope. I just wasnt very motivated to redo the stuff back then (that was 12.2004/01.2005, btw...looong time ago).
Also, the code is not exactly fun to work on (i should have read a few more pages in that c++ book before writing the thing)...
I do have worked on Slifty since then, but got stuck with some things...I really cant promise if ill ever solve them. But, maybe... :)
